2 Figure 1 AKI-induced distant organ effects. AKI leads to changes in distant organs, including brain, lungs, heart, liver, gastrointestinal tract, and bone marrow. Changes have been described in organ function, microvascular inflammation and coagulation, cell apoptosis, transporter activity, oxidative stress, and transcriptional responses.
